The Commission released the UPSC ESE 2025 Mains exam schedule on the official website at upsc.gov.in. Candidates who have cleared the Prelims exam will be appearing for the Mains exam on August 10, 2025. The schedule of the Mains exam is mentioned below:

According to the notice pdf, the IES Mains exam will be held in two shifts on a single day. The first ESE Main exam shift will be conducted from 9 AM to 12 noon (Paper I) and the second shift will be held from 2:30 to 5:30 PM (Paper II). Check the table for detailed information:

Date and Day

Time

Subject

August 10, 2025 (Sunday)

9 to 12 Noon

Discipline Specific Paper (Paper-I): Civil, Mechanical, Electrical, Electronics & Telecommunication Engineering (Conventional, 3 hrs, 300 Marks)

August 10, 2025 (Sunday)

2:30 to 5:30 PM

Discipline Specific Paper (Paper-II): Civil, Mechanical, Electrical, Electronics & Telecommunication Engineering (Conventional, 3 hrs, 300 Marks)

The UPSC IES 2025 Mains exam will be conducted on August 10, 2025. It is a descriptive type exam. That assesses candidates' technical knowledge and problem-solving abilities in engineering disciplines. The Engineering Services Mains Examination  consists of two conventional-type papers in engineering disciplines, each with a duration of three hours and a maximum score of 600 (300 marks in each paper).
